Python帮助定义列表

时间:2016-01-15 07:04:25

标签: python

定义一个列表的最佳方法是什么,该列表将所有输入的数字输入并仅打印该列表中可被3整除的数字?

def numbers(list):
    #code for defining a list
    pass

3 个答案:

答案 0 :(得分:0)

你可以这样做:

numbers = [1,2,3,4,5]
for n in numbers:
    if n % 3 == 0:
        print n

第3行将数字除以3,如果余数为0(使其可被3整除),则打印数字。

答案 1 :(得分:0)

这个方法只需要2个列表,x是你选择输入的列表作为你想要的数字的限制,y列表返回{{ 1}} 可以被 3 整除。

x

答案 2 :(得分:-1)

x = []
n = input("enter length:")
for i in range(1, int(n)): 
     k=input("enter value:") 
     x.append(k) 
for j in x:
     if int(j) % 3 == 0:
     print(j)

检查此代码是否对您有帮助。Output Image